Low compression on a single cylinder can be caused by an
external leak or a leak to a coolant passage.
A compression leak to the coolant will normally be detected
by loss of coolant as the coolant is blown from the cooling
system.
External cylinder head gasket leaks can be detected visu-
ally. Liquid soap can be used to locate external leaks.
The cause of piston ring wear can range from wear over a
long period of service to a dust-out in a short period be-
cause of poor maintenance of the air intake system.
